Publication number: 20210128869Abstract: Briefly summarized, embodiments disclosed herein are directed to apparatus and methods for removing an occlusion from an indwelling catheter. The system can include a pressurized fluid conduit for delivering pressurized fluid to an occlusion site, and ablating the occlusion. A negative pressure source in fluid communication with the catheter lumen can then aspirate the occlusion. The positive pressure source can provide a pulsed pressurized fluid to facilitate ablation. The system can also include tip tracking and tip location systems to ensure the pressurized fluid conduit does not extend beyond the catheter lumen, causing damage to the vasculature. Publication number: 20210121675Abstract: Disclosed herein are systems, devices, and methods for thrombolysis. For example, a medical device for thrombolysis can include a conduit, a supply reservoir, and a waste reservoir. The conduit can be configured to insert into a lumen of a venous access device having an intraluminal clot. The conduit can include a supply lumen configured to convey an aqueous thrombolytic composition from the supply reservoir through an opening in a distal-end portion of the conduit to the intraluminal clot. The waste reservoir can be configured to collect waste from the lumen of the venous access device including fibrin fragments, platelets, red blood cells, or spent solution of the thrombolytic composition used to break down the intraluminal clot. Patent number: 10956304Abstract: Dynamically instrumenting code that executes based on a historic execution of a subject executable entity. Historic execution information for a subject executable entity is accessed. The historic execution information includes execution state information for at least one point in time in the historic execution the executable entity. Diagnostic code instruction(s) are identified, for instrumenting subject code instruction(s) of the executable entity. The subject code instruction(s) are virtually executed based at least on supplying the subject code instruction(s) with data from the historic execution information. While virtually executing the identified executable code instruction(s), the diagnostic code instruction(s) are also executed. Patent number: 10943290Abstract: A method that includes replacing a standard keyboard displayed on a display of a first mobile device with a second shopping keyboard. The second shopping keyboard includes third keys that represent purchasable items (a product and/or service). After one of the third keys, which represents a particular item, is selected, a sharing option and/or purchasing option is/are displayed. When selected, the sharing option supplies information about the particular item to a messaging application that communicates the information to a second mobile device. When selected, the purchasing option initiates purchase of the particular item. The method may also include displaying a first shopping keyboard comprising second keys representing businesses. After one of the second keys, representing a particular business, is selected, the second shopping keyboard is displayed. Patent number: 10914827Abstract: An electronic device includes a first portion, a second portion, and a joint moveably coupling the first and second portions for angular adjustment between the first and second portions. A speaker is fixed on the first portion at a first known distance from the joint, and a microphone is fixed on the second portion at a second known distance from the joint. An angle sensing machine is configured to emit a known sound from the speaker, detect the known sound at the microphone, and measure a transmission time of the known sound from speaker to microphone.
